If you try starting your car and there’s no sign of starting or even a click, and your interior lights are bright, it may be an indication of a bad starter relay. Causes & fixes for a car not starting with no clicking. The most common sign of a faulty or failing starter relay is that your car won’t start when you try to start it. If your car won’t start and it doesn’t make any noise when you turn the key, either your battery is bad or the starter isn’t working. Start by jumping or replacing the battery.
